“Operation: Warm feet, Happy Feet”

Courtesy Gabriel Lopez, The South Texas Afghanistan Iraq Veterans Association takes great joy in conducting the 5th annual “Operation: Warm feet, Happy Feet” This year 50 children from two schools will receive a brand new pair of tennis shoes. Santa Maria Elementary located at 3817 Santa Maria St. will receive the shoes at 09:30 am on Thursday
